placehold_image
Generate a placeholder image URL with custom size, colors, and text (no network call).

| Parameter | Type | Required |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
font | string | — | Font name (roboto, lato, open-sans, montserrat, etc.). |
text | string | — | Custom text overlay. |
width | number | — | Image width in pixels (default 300, max 4000). |
height | number | — | Image height in pixels (default: same as width). |
background | string | — | Background hex color (default: CCCCCC). |
foreground | string | — | Text hex color (default: 333333). |
Parameters from the server's own tool schema.
Why placehold_image is rated Low
This is a read operation—it retrieves/returns generated content (a URL string) with no irreversible changes, no code execution with external effects, no financial impact, and no destructive capability. The most severe applicable category is Read.
From the tool's definition Tool generates and returns a placeholder image URL with custom parameters (size, colors, text). The description explicitly states '(no network call)', indicating it computes or constructs a URL response without side effects or data modification.
